Report: Bioscience has $3.5B impact
Monday, January 26, 2009 (363 reads)


From high-level cancer research to fertilizer manufacturing, Oregon’s wide-ranging bioscience industry accounted for $3.5 billion of economic activity in 2007, or about 2.2 percent of the state’s GDP.

The Oregon Translational Research and Drug Development Institute (OTRADI) announced today that it has experimentally tested and identified a significant number of biological compounds with previously unknown abilities to block more than 75 percent of the growth of some fungi, parasites that cause malaria, and some bacteria, such as Staphylococcus aureus (Staph A) and Escherichia (E coli). Oregon’s newest laboratory achieved these results in its first six weeks of operation.
